High chrome white iron castings are specified wherever severe abrasion and corrosion combine to destroy ordinary steel components. The chromium carbide microstructure provides exceptional resistance to low-stress scratching abrasion and corrosive wear.
Pump casings, impellers, suction liners (throatbushes), side liners and shaft sleeves for centrifugal slurry pumps in mineral processing, tailings handling and coal preparation. High chrome iron dramatically outperforms standard rubber-lined pumps in high-temperature or chemically aggressive slurry service.
Feed chamber liners, cylindrical section liners, apex sections (spigots) and vortex finders for hydrocyclones in classification, desliming and thickening circuits. High chrome iron provides 3-5x the wear life of polyurethane liners in coarse, high-density slurry applications.
Cast high chrome iron pipe elbows, 45° and 90° bends, tee sections and straight pipe for abrasive slurry transfer lines. Manufactured with standard flange connections (ANSI, DIN, AS) or custom spigot/socket ends to suit existing piping systems.
Spiral classifier scroll liners and tank wear plates, rake classifier tine liners and screw conveyor flight liners for classification of fine mineral slurries. Wear-resistant liners for mechanical classifiers handling highly abrasive fine ground ore pulp.
Impact-resistant liner plates for transfer chutes, loading boxes, feed hoppers and discharge chutes. Available as flat liner tiles, radius sections and formed liners. High chrome iron provides superior life to AR steel plate in fine, high-velocity abrasive material flow applications.
